EUVDB-ID: #VU47498
Risk: Low
CVSSv3.1: 5.7 [CVSS:3.1/AV:N/AC:L/PR:H/UI:N/S:U/C:H/I:N/A:H/E:U/RL:O/RC:C]
CVE-ID: CVE-2019-5445
CWE-ID:
CWE-77 - Command injection
Exploit availability: No
DescriptionThe vulnerability allows a remote user to perform a denial of service (DoS) attack.
The vulnerability exists due to improper input validation within the SSH CLI interface. A remote privileged user can send a specially crafted command to the interface and crash it.
Install updates from vendor's website.
Vulnerable software versionsEdgeMAX EdgeSwitch: 1.0.1 - 1.8.1

EUVDB-ID: #VU47499
Risk: Low
CVSSv3.1: 6.3 [CVSS:3.1/AV:N/AC:L/PR:H/UI:N/S:U/C:H/I:H/A:H/E:U/RL:O/RC:C]
CVE-ID: CVE-2019-5446
CWE-ID:
CWE-77 - Command injection
Exploit availability: No
DescriptionThe vulnerability allows a remote user to escalate privileges on the device.
The vulnerability exists due to improper input validation. A remote administrator can send specially crafted request to the device and execute arbitrary commands as root.
Install updates from vendor's website.
Vulnerable software versionsEdgeMAX EdgeSwitch: 1.0.1 - 1.8.1
